By Lorenzo J. Reyna, BarkBoard/247Sports: It’s been four years since Fresno State produced a draft pick at wide receiver – with KeeSean Johnson representing the last one in 2019. Jalen Moreno-Cropper presents the best chance of breaking that dry spell.
Cropper did have a fifth year of college eligibility available to him in 2023, but it was well-known that he would likely pursue the NFL after the 2022 season.
